FinanceEstonia, FinTech Latvia Association, and Rockit Vilnius Unite to Spotlight Baltic FinTech Innovation

FinanceEstonia, FinTech Latvia Association, and Rockit Vilnius Unite to Spotlight Baltic FinTech Innovation

December 11, 2025 , Vilnius – FinanceEstonia, the Fintech Latvia Association, and Rockit Vilnius have signed a memorandum of understanding (MoU) to create an event that showcases Baltic fintech innovation and positions the region as the next global powerhouse for fintech development. The partnership leverages the Baltics’ unique strengths, including the highest concentration of unicorns per capita globally, a deep reservoir of expertise, and cutting-edge know-how in building and scaling technology companies. The organizations aim to amplify the region’s reputation as a fintech innovation hub while fostering collaboration across borders. “The Baltics have a proven track record of producing global fintech leaders. This memorandum is our commitment to amplifying that success and making the region synonymous with innovation,” said  Kaido Saar , Chairman of the Management Board of FinanceEstonia. A key initiative under this collaboration is  Baltic FinTech Days , set to convene over 1,000 participants, more than 300 companies, 70 expert speakers, and 25 partners on the 2nd and 3rd of April 2025 at the City Hall in Vilnius. This event will rotate annually among the Baltic capitals, ensuring Lithuania, Latvia, and Estonia each have a platform to spotlight their ecosystems while strengthening regional cooperation. “Rooted in the belief that we are stronger together this partnership is about firmly positioning the Baltics on the global fintech map. By joining forces, we strive to ensure that our ecosystems thrive locally and gain recognition internationally. The Baltics have much to celebrate, from Wise in Estonia and TransferGo in Lithuania to Mintos in Latvia, and many more. Baltic fintech companies are leaving a significant mark on the global financial landscape,” said Tina Luse , Managing Director of Fintech Latvia Association The agreement unites Lithuania, Latvia, and Estonia’s vibrant ecosystems and sets a platform for increased collaboration among startups, corporates, and regulators. It also markets the region as a hotbed for fintech innovation, with a focus on advancing digital transformation, fostering entrepreneurship, and driving future growth. ‘This collaboration reflects our shared ambition to position the Baltics as a powerhouse of fintech innovation, leveraging our collective strengths to lead in creating impactful financial solutions,” said  Lina Žemaitytė – Kirkman , Head of Rockit Vilnius. This initiative is an unequivocal statement of the Baltics’ ambition to lead the way in fintech and attract global recognition as a hub of innovation and excellence. Baltic Fintech Days 2025: The Most Vibrant Fintech Experience in Europe

Baltic Fintech Days 2025: The Most Vibrant Fintech Experience in Europe

Vilnius, Lithuania – April 2nd & 3rd, 2025  – The entire Baltic Fintech ecosystem is coming together to showcase its unmatched innovation to the world at the largest and most vibrant fintech event in the region. The  Baltic Fintech Days   will bring over 1,000 participants, more than 25 partners, and over 70 speakers from around the globe to Vilnius, creating the most dynamic fintech experience Europe has ever seen. This event will unite the entire Baltic Fintech community, highlighting the region's cutting-edge developments and its collective strength on an international stage. Hosted in Vilnius, the capital of Lithuania, this landmark event will showcase the innovation, digital excellence, and entrepreneurial spirit that has made the Baltics the region with the highest density of tech unicorns per capita in the world. These two days will be an opportunity to explore industry-defining ideas and disruptive technologies, designed to transform financial services from the ground up. A Fintech Powerhouse The Baltics are known for their deep expertise in building and scaling technology companies, and Baltic Fintech Days 2025 will demonstrate how the region has mastered the art of developing tech-based financial solutions. With participants from Estonia, Latvia and Lithuania, Europe, the UK, the Middle East, and Asia, this event is set to attract a truly international audience, eager to explore the next big leap in Fintech. Attendees will have the chance to connect with key decision-makers, innovators, and industry leaders. Whether it’s discovering new partners, collaborators, or the broader fintech community, Baltic Fintech Days 2025 will provide the perfect platform for expanding business opportunities beyond borders. “Lithuania has worked tirelessly to build a thriving fintech ecosystem. By fostering collaboration between the public and private sectors, we have attracted talent from across the world and created a nurturing environment for innovation to flourish,”  says Vaida Česnulevičiūtė Markevičienė, Vice Minister of Finance of Lithuania.  “Baltic Fintech Days is a testament to our progress and the region’s bright future as a fintech hub.” Key Themes for 2025 The event will spotlight six key themes, sparking discussions that prepare attendees for the future of financial services and the innovations shaping it: Cognitive Finance  – How exponential technologies make financial services more aware of user-specific and contextual needs. Compliance Technology  – The latest in fraud prevention and compliance tech that anticipates criminal activities. Money and Payments  – Exploring the future of cryptocurrencies, central bank digital currencies, seamless payments, and cross-border transactions. Ever-present Finance  – How financial services are embedding into other industries through APIs, platform banking, and beyond to become persistent in users lives. Open Finance  – The next stage in open banking, making financial data flow seamlessly across jurisdictions with user consent. Blended Finance  – How industries like automotive, healthcare, and travel are integrating financial services to solve cross-industry challenges.   “Estonia has led the way in digital innovation globally, with 99% of government services available online. Our Fintech founders from organizations like Skype, Wise, Bolt and Veriff continue to build successful unicorns and reinvest their know-how, talent, and capital into the region,”  says Ian Kala, Head of Fintech at Finance Estonia.  “This culture of reinvention positions the Baltics as the leading Fintech region globally.”   A Global Platform for Fintech Innovation Baltic Fintech Days 2025 will bring attention to the incredible potential of the Baltic region, not just for local startups but also for global companies looking to tap into a the most dynamic markets for Fintech in Europe. “Together, the Baltic countries can present themselves as a fintech powerhouse to the world,”  says Tina Luse, Head of the Latvian Fintech Association.  “We are building something special here, and this event will show just how far our region has come in leading the next wave of fintech innovation.”   For those unfamiliar with the region, this is the ideal opportunity to visit and see firsthand what the global financial world is raving about. The Baltics are emerging as a fintech innovation hub, ready to attract talent, investment, and ideas that will shape the future of the industry. "Bridging Gaps: Marijus Andrijauskas on Lithuania’s Startup Expansion"

"Bridging Gaps: Marijus Andrijauskas on Lithuania’s Startup Expansion"

Despite global economic challenges, Lithuania's startup ecosystem demonstrated resilience and growth. By 2023, the country had over 800 active startups, employing more than 16,000 people and startups raised a total of €272 million.  Notably, the average investment per startup grew to €10 million, highlighting a focus on larger deals and sustainable growth. The tech ecosystem saw significant investments in sectors such as cybersecurity, energy, and biotech, with standout companies like Nord Security and PVcase, each securing $100 million in funding. Although the overall amount decreased, Lithuania remained one of the few European countries to experience an increase in investments by September 2023, alongside Romania and Luxembourg. The ecosystem continues to expand, supported by initiatives from venture capital and tech hubs, such as Rockit , aimed at nurturing early-stage startups. This focus on profitability and innovation signals a promising future for Lithuania’s entrepreneurial landscape. We are happy to share our partner’s FIRSTPICK insights about Lithuanian startup ecosystem and we welcome you to a quick interview with Marijus Andrijauskas, Partner at FIRSTPICK. Marijus, how do you see the evolution of Lithuania’s startup ecosystem in the next 3 to 5 years? Do you think the gap between startups in Vilnius and other regions will change? Lithuania’s startup ecosystem has grown rapidly in recent years and continues to head in the right direction. Over the next 3 to 5 years, we can expect even more collaboration between startups, venture funds, accelerators, hubs, associations, and business angel networks. The growing involvement of institutional players is also creating a strong foundation for future growth. With improved access to capital, mentoring, and talent, Lithuania is becoming an increasingly attractive destination for innovation. While Vilnius remains the startup epicenter due to its concentration of resources and talent, other cities like Kaunas and Klaipėda are gaining momentum. Kaunas benefits from its technical universities, and Klaipėda is becoming a promising tech hub, attracting founders and entrepreneurs. Interestingly, coastal cities like Palanga and Nida are turning into seasonal startup hubs during the summer, offering a great quality of life and attracting innovators. Smaller cities still need to build unique offerings through university partnerships or specialized infrastructure, but government programs are already helping to support regional development. Initiatives from ecosystem players like Rockit are essential in spreading resources and leveling the playing field for startups across the country. What strengths set Lithuania’s startup ecosystem apart, and how does VC and communities like ROCKIT support this growth? To avoid gaps like those seen in Estonia, it’s crucial to focus on nurturing early-stage startups now. Encouraging and enabling wanna-be founders to make their first attempts, without fear of failure, will help maintain a healthy pipeline of new ventures. Despite economic challenges that may deter senior professionals, investing in early-stage development is vital. Hubs like Rockit are playing an invaluable role in addressing these needs. They are not only focused on Vilnius but are also extending their reach to regional areas, ensuring that this culture of innovation and entrepreneurship can spread throughout the country. By bringing together the resources and networks necessary to support budding entrepreneurs, Rockit is helping to cultivate a new generation of startups that will continue to fuel Lithuania’s growth. As you mentioned, ROCKIT's Pre-Acceleration Program focuses on early-stage startups. What are the key factors that help these programs prepare startups for investment? As a VC, we screen hundreds of startups, and typically only around 2% are ready for investment. Many promising teams fall short, not because their ideas are weak, but due to gaps in preparation, validation, understanding of numbers, and familiarity with the VC landscape. This is where pre-acceleration programs, like ROCKIT’s, play a crucial role. These programs equip startups with the knowledge and tools they need to bridge these gaps. ROCKIT’s Pre-Acceleration Program is a great example, offering structure and guidance for early-stage founders who aim to pursue VC funding later. Not only does it increase their chances of securing investment, but it also helps founders evaluate whether entrepreneurship is the right path for them. Marijus, in your opinion, what sectors within the Lithuanian startup ecosystem are currently underserved or have the most untapped potential, and how can accelerators or public initiatives address this? One sector with untapped potential in Lithuania is AI. While we’ve seen some movement and ideas developing, much of it revolves around generative AI, and we’re still catching up with the broader AI wave. However, this is the right direction, and I believe AI will soon become a powerful sector in our ecosystem. To fully unlock this potential, accelerators and public initiatives need to focus on enabling and supporting AI innovation. By concentrating our efforts, we can foster a stronger AI presence in Lithuania, ensuring the sector flourishes in the coming years. Thank you Marijus for such and insightful interview! Five years of “Rockit”: growing startup value and regional expansion

Five years of “Rockit”: growing startup value and regional expansion

We enter a new phase as it completes our fifth year of operations. The centre, which was established in Vilnius and unites regional and international startups, is gaining ground in other Lithuanian cities, encouraging local startups to set up technology businesses, according to a press release. According to Lina Žemaitytė-Kirkman, CEO of “Rockit”, in the five years that the centre has been operating, the Lithuanian fintech ecosystem has grown considerably, with the number of fintech companies approaching 300. This, she says, is due to a strong partnership between businesses and a local government.   “In addition, the fact that international accelerators such as “Plug and Play” are coming to the country, bringing their international circle of mentors, investors and speakers, shows Lithuania's attractiveness for the creation and development of fast-growing technology businesses. It is therefore natural that the next step is to strengthen the country's entire startup ecosystem, with a greater focus on other regions,” says L. Žemaitytė-Kirkman.   The value of Lithuania's startup ecosystem has grown more than 7 times in five years, from €1.9 billion in 2018 to €13.7 billion last year, according to “Dealroom’s” data.   “The number of startups creating sustainable innovations has grown by a tenth in the last year alone, and among all members of the “Rockit” community, nearly a third of them. We are therefore delighted to develop our cooperation with “Rockit”, the centre for sustainable innovation, to promote the creation and fostering of a sustainable society,” says Remy Salters, Head of the Finance Division at “Swedbank”.   Together with “Swedbank”, the Centre for Financial Technology and Innovation “Rockit” organises the “Sustainability Forum”, which brings together startups developing sustainability technologies. The event, which has been held for two consecutive years, is also under the auspices of the Ministry of Finance of the Republic of Lithuania.   The activity and strength of the community are demonstrated by the annual “Lithuanian Fintech Awards”, which recognise and reward the sector and its achievements. This year's fourth edition of the Awards featured the only one of its kind so far - the Lithuanian Fintech Map. It divides all 277 fintech companies in the country into 10 different categories - payments, digital banking, savings and investments, lending, etc. Encourage the development of startups in the regions Although based in Vilnius, “Rockit” has been helping startups in other Lithuanian cities to enter broader business markets since spring this year. According to the CEO of the centre L. Žemaitytė-Kirkman, creating favourable conditions for startups in Central and Western Lithuania and encouraging the development of product ideas will also help to reduce the regional divide.   “Our mission is to build a stronger and more vibrant regional startup ecosystem and to empower entrepreneurial people to reach their full potential. With Rockit's international experience, extensive network of contacts, mentors and companies, we are ready to accelerate every startup's journey towards success,” says the CEO of “Rockit”.   The “Startup Acceleration and Incubation Programme 2024-2026” has been launched to encourage technology centres to take action to create the right conditions for startups and to promote the development of their product ideas. It is being implemented by Rockit with funding from the Innovation Agency.   The “Startup Acceleration and Incubation Programme 2024-2026” has a number of key objectives, including the organisation of different stages of startup programme cycles, from the earliest stage through to the readiness to raise capital. Business and science intensives will also be organised to commercialise scientific solutions and promote the creation of science-intensive businesses.   As foreseen in the project strategy, “Rockit’s” offices will open in Kaunas and Klaipėda shortly. Each of them will be equipped with spaces for incubating startups: about 20 workplaces, event spaces, etc. These co-working spaces will allow young and startup technology companies to gain knowledge and experience not only from Lithuanian but also from foreign experts, and to put it into practice.   The centres in Kaunas and Klaipėda will also provide incubation and acceleration services for young technology companies in the region. At least 60 new startups are expected to emerge in Western and Central Lithuania over the three years of the program.
